MySQL为什么不能持久存储数据

更新时间:02-11 教程 由 颜若惜 分享

问题:MySQL为什么不能持久存储数据?

MySQL是一个开源的关系型数据库管理系统,它的存储机制和限制直接影响了它的数据持久性。虽然MySQL可以存储数据,但是不能持久存储数据,这是因为以下几个方面的限制:

1. 内存限制

MySQL的内存限制是一个主要限制因素。MySQL使用内存缓存来提高性能,但是当内存不足时,MySQL会将数据写入磁盘,这会导致数据持久性的问题。

2. 磁盘限制

MySQL的磁盘限制也是一个主要限制因素。MySQL使用磁盘来存储数据,但是磁盘有容量限制,一旦磁盘满了,就不能再写入数据,这也会导致数据持久性的问题。

3. 数据库配置

MySQL的数据库配置也会影响数据的持久性。如果MySQL的配置不正确,可能会导致数据丢失或不完整,这也会影响数据的持久性。

4. 数据库备份

数据库备份也会影响数据的持久性。如果没有进行定期备份,一旦出现数据丢失或损坏,就无法恢复数据,这也会影响数据的持久性。

综上所述,MySQL不能持久存储数据的原因是由于内存限制、磁盘限制、数据库配置和数据库备份等方面的限制。为了确保数据的持久性,需要定期备份数据,正确配置数据库,并确保系统具有足够的内存和磁盘空间。

声明:关于《MySQL为什么不能持久存储数据》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2270333.html